In recent years, the allure of gold as a protected-haven asset has drawn many investors to contemplate Gold Particular person Retirement Accounts (IRAs) as a viable possibility for retirement savings. Gold IRAs permit individuals to put money into bodily gold and different treasured metals, offering a hedge in opposition to inflation and financial uncertainty. This article will explore what Gold IRAs are, how they work, their advantages and disadvantages, and the best way to set one up.
What's a Gold IRA?
A Gold IRA is a sort of self-directed Particular person Retirement Account that permits traders to carry bodily gold, silver, platinum, and palladium as part of their retirement portfolio. Unlike traditional IRAs, which sometimes hold paper belongings like stocks and bonds, Gold IRAs provide the chance to invest in tangible assets that can doubtlessly retain worth throughout economic downturns.
How Gold IRAs Work
Gold IRAs operate equally to plain IRAs, with a couple of key differences. Here’s how they work:
- Account Setup: To ascertain a Gold IRA, you could first select a custodian that makes a speciality of self-directed IRAs. This custodian will handle your account and ensure compliance with IRS regulations.
- Funding the Account: You can fund your Gold IRA through numerous strategies, including rolling over funds from an existing retirement account (like a 401(k) or conventional IRA) or making direct contributions. Be aware that there are annual contribution limits set by the IRS.
- Purchasing Valuable Metals: Once your account is funded, you'll be able to instruct your custodian to buy authorised treasured metals on your behalf. The IRS has particular requirements relating to the sorts of metals that can be held in a Gold IRA, together with minimum purity standards.
- Storage: The bodily gold and other metals have to be saved in an approved depository. The IRS mandates that you can't keep the metals at dwelling; they must be held in a secure, IRS-authorized facility.
- Withdrawals: Whenever you reach retirement age, you possibly can withdraw your gold in bodily kind or liquidate it for money. Nonetheless, keep in mind that withdrawals may be subject to taxes and penalties if taken earlier than age 59½.
Advantages of Gold IRAs
Investing in a Gold IRA affords a number of benefits:
- Hedge In opposition to Inflation: Gold has traditionally maintained its value over time, making it a well-liked choice for buyers looking to protect their wealth from inflation and forex fluctuations.
- Diversification: Including gold in your retirement portfolio can provide diversification, lowering total portfolio danger. Valuable metals often perform in a different way than stocks and bonds, which could be useful throughout market volatility.
- Tangible Asset: trusted gold-backed ira providers usa In contrast to paper investments, gold is a bodily asset that you would be able to hold. This tangibility can provide peace of thoughts, especially throughout financial uncertainty.
- Tax Advantages: Gold IRAs supply the same tax benefits as traditional IRAs. Contributions may be tax-deductible, and your investments can grow tax-deferred until you make withdrawals.
- Wealth Preservation: Gold has been a retailer of value for centuries, and many investors view it as a strategy to preserve wealth for future generations.
Disadvantages of Gold IRAs
Despite their advantages, Gold IRAs additionally include some drawbacks:
- Higher Fees: Gold IRAs typically have increased fees compared to conventional IRAs. These charges may include account setup charges, storage fees, and transaction fees for buying gold.
- Limited Funding Choices: Whereas Gold IRAs permit for investment in treasured metals, they do not present the same vary of investment options as conventional IRAs. This limitation may not appeal to all traders.
- Market Volatility: Though gold is often seen as a safe-haven asset, its worth can still be unstable. Investors must be prepared for fluctuations in the value of their gold holdings.
- Complex Rules: The IRS has specific guidelines concerning Gold IRAs, together with which metals are eligible and the way they should be stored. Navigating these regulations can be complex, and it’s essential to work with a educated custodian.
- No Income Technology: Gold does not produce dividends or curiosity, which signifies that it does not generate income like stocks or bonds. This can be a disadvantage for traders searching for common revenue from their retirement accounts.
Learn how to Set up a Gold IRA
Setting up a Gold IRA entails a number of steps:
- Select a Custodian: Analysis and select a reputable custodian that focuses on Gold IRAs. Search for one with constructive critiques, clear fees, and a stable monitor record.
- Open Your Account: Complete the necessary paperwork to open your Gold IRA account. This usually contains offering private data and deciding on your account sort (traditional or Roth).
- Fund Your Account: Resolve how you need to fund your Gold IRA. You may roll over funds from an current retirement account or make direct contributions.
- Select Your Treasured Metals: Work together with your custodian to decide on the approved treasured metals you wish to invest in. Be certain that the metals meet the IRS purity requirements.
- Arrange for Storage: Your custodian will assist you to arrange for the secure storage of your metals in an IRS-accredited depository.
- Monitor Your Investment: Commonly evaluate your Gold IRA and keep knowledgeable about market developments and adjustments in IRS rules.
